Course structure

• Foundations of Crisis Management in Engineering
• Risk Assessment and Mitigation Strategies
• Decision-Making Under Pressure
• Communication Strategies for Crisis Situations
• Leadership and Team Dynamics in High-Stress Environments
• Incident Response Planning and Execution
• Business Continuity and Disaster Recovery
• Ethical and Legal Considerations in Crisis Management
• Post-Crisis Evaluation and Learning
• Emerging Technologies in Crisis Management

Career path

Crisis Management Engineer

Specializes in mitigating risks and managing emergencies in engineering projects, ensuring minimal disruption and maximum safety.

Disaster Recovery Specialist

Focuses on restoring operations post-crisis, leveraging engineering expertise to rebuild infrastructure and systems efficiently.

Risk Assessment Analyst

Evaluates potential threats to engineering projects, providing data-driven insights to prevent crises before they occur.
